Output d5c9399621350371ac4b84f6a2afa799cb64c8c3d0aadf1ae3ccb65dcc32a816:20

value
704481
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c379cbb11d1b7eeca08e51ef17c480c9cf182ed OP_EQUALVERIFY OP_CHECKSIG
address
19QbnevXNZx7zqcHCfZFxz2pURyjoFPCJf
transaction
d5c9399621350371ac4b84f6a2afa799cb64c8c3d0aadf1ae3ccb65dcc32a816
confirmations
201825
spent
true